Choosing the Right Cables and Ports

Not all cables and ports support 4K at 60Hz. Using incompatible hardware can result in lower resolution or refresh rates. Select cables and ports that are specifically rated for 4K 60Hz output.

DisplayPort vs. HDMI

Both DisplayPort and HDMI can support 4K at 60Hz, but version matters. Ensure your hardware supports:

  • DisplayPort 1.4 or higher
  • HDMI 2.0 or higher

Using cables that meet these standards will prevent issues like flickering or resolution drops.

Quality Matters

Invest in high-quality, certified cables. Cheap or generic cables may not reliably transmit the full 4K 60Hz signal, leading to display problems.

Configuring Your Hardware

Proper configuration of your graphics card and monitor settings ensures the best performance. Follow these steps:

  • Update your graphics drivers to the latest version.
  • Set the display resolution to 3840×2160 in display settings.
  • Adjust the refresh rate to 60Hz in advanced display settings.

Checking Compatibility

Verify that your graphics card supports 4K at 60Hz. Older or integrated GPUs may have limitations. Consult the manufacturer’s specifications to confirm.
